The Geopolitical Environment and Political Ecosystem of Israel

Abstract:

Yossi Verter will discuss the map of threats to Israel’s security amid the contemporary developments in the Middle East. He proposes that there are two main strategic threats to this. The first threat is the collapse of the Palestinian authority and the second is the possibility of an all-out war with Hezbollah in the north of the country. In addition, Mr Verter will also present his views on the stalemate in the peace process with the Palestinians and the risk of a one-state for two peoples solution.

About the Speakers
Yossi Verter Chief Political Writer Haaretz Daily, Tel Aviv

Yossi Verter is one of Israel’s leading columnists. He is the chief political writer of “Haaretz Daily” since 1996. He specializes in writing about the internal domestic politics of Israel and has covered 8 general elections including the most recent one in 2015.

Prior to 1996, he worked as an investigative reporter for 2 years in “Uvda”, a leading weekly magazine TV programme produced by Channel 2. Before joining Channel 2, he was a correspondent for Israel’s national newspaper “Hadashot Daily” from 1984 to 1993 covering various news including crime and politics. He was also appointed as Bureau Chief for Hadashot’s offices in London and New York from 1990 to 1992. Mr Verter studied history at Tel Aviv University and is fluent in both English and Hebrew.
